Materials Data on Sc2CuRu by Materials Project
Sc2RuCu is Heusler structured and crystallizes in the cubic Fm-3m space group. The structure is three-dimensional. Sc is bonded in a body-centered cubic geometry to four equivalent Ru and four equivalent Cu atoms. All Sc–Ru bond lengths are 2.80 Å. All Sc–Cu bond lengths are 2.80 Å. Ru is bonded in a body-centered cubic geometry to eight equivalent Sc atoms. Cu is bonded in a body-centered cubic geometry to eight equivalent Sc atoms.
